Tasting Notes and Characteristics:
Sipping Elouan Chardonnay is a refreshing experience, with bright notes of crisp apple, ripe pear, and a hint of citrus that glide smoothly across the palate, balanced by subtle oak and a creamy texture. Crafted in the United States with an ABV of 13.5%, this wine reflects the cool coastal influences that shape Oregon’s vineyards, giving it both vibrancy and depth. Its lively acidity makes it an excellent companion for seafood or roast chicken, elevating everyday meals into something special while highlighting the wine’s versatility and food-friendly character.
Producer Information: Copper Cane Wines & Provisions
Copper Cane Wines & Provisions is a California-based winery rooted in the rich viticultural heritage of the West Coast, particularly drawing from regions like Napa Valley and Sonoma. The producer is known for its hands-on approach to winemaking, focusing on small-lot production that highlights the unique character of each vineyard site. Copper Cane crafts a diverse portfolio that includes Pinot Noir and Chardonnay under labels such as Belle Glos and Elouan, as well as Cabernet Sauvignon through Quilt. Their commitment to regional expression and meticulous craftsmanship extends across their range, offering wines that capture the essence of California’s varied terroirs.
